Alamo City Urgent Care is seeking a dedicated and experienced Physician Assistant (PA) or Nurse Practitioner (NP) to join our dynamic clinical team. This role is ideal for a provider who thrives in a fast-paced urgent care environment and is committed to delivering high-quality, patient-centered care. You will work collaboratively with physicians and support staff while managing a diverse range of acute medical conditions.

What You'll Do

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ide comprehensive patient care in a high-volume urgent care setting
  • Evaluate, diagnose, and treat a wide variety of acute illnesses and injuries
  • Perform procedures within scope of practice and training
  • Collaborate closely with supervising physicians and interdisciplinary team members
  • Actively participate in daily team huddles and support clinical staff with workflow and process improvements
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ation in the electronic medical record (EMR) system
  • Utilize and support AI-assisted EMR documentation tools as appropriate

What You Bring

Qualifications & Requirements

  • Active and unrestricted PA or NP license in the state of Texas
  • Minimum of 2 years of urgent care experience preferred
  • National certification:
    • PA: NCCPA
    • NP: AANP or ANCC
  • DEA license (or ability to obtain within 90 days)
  • DOT certification preferred (or ability to obtain within 90 days)
  • ACLS and PALS certifications preferred but not required
  • Strong clinical judgment with the 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ills
